THEY DEMAND THAT THEIR REQUESTS "BE HEARD"

A citizen platform is born for the Arrecife dog pound, which they describe as a "concentration camp"

They denounce "the life of suffering of the pets that are there." "Those animals are being left to die of sadness"

A group of citizens "animal lovers" has grouped together in a platform to try to ensure that their requests regarding the Arrecife dog pound, which they compare to "a concentration camp", are "heard and solutions are given to the life of suffering of the pets that are there."

The 'Platform against animal abuse', which for now states that it is made up of about fifteen people, denounces that in the Arrecife dog pound "there are dogs that have been living in cold cages for years and sleeping on the floor, with no more heat than that given to them by a group of volunteers who regularly visit them."

Likewise, it denounces that "the veterinary attention is practically nil, given that the municipal veterinarian has been on medical leave for quite some time, and there has been no other professional in his place to ensure the well-being of these defenseless animals."

"The dogs have a very high level of stress due to the lack of walks and socialization, since all they do is walk around inside their enclosures (from which they never leave) and any veterinarian worth their salt knows what that means," he adds. In addition, the 'Platform against animal abuse' points out that "there are no reports of the character of the dogs or why they are being held in that center."

 

They criticize the "excuses" for not authorizing them to walk the dogs


In addition, the 'Platform against animal abuse' claims to have asked "countless times" to be allowed to walk the dogs, "even in the inner courtyard of the facilities." Something that they believe would "improve their character" and that, with "socialization with other dogs and people, would allow their visualization and enable adoptions."

However, the members of this Platform point out that "one of the excuses" that has been given to them "for not authorizing these contacts of the volunteers with the animals is the lack of civil liability insurance that can cover possible accidents that may occur", despite the fact that they claim to be willing to pay their own insurance, "so that the City Council would be exempt from any type of responsibility."

The Platform also points out that members of this group have requested the adoption of some animals, "adoptions that could have been resolved" and that they consider that if it has not been done "it is not due to legal problems, but to a lack of will."

 

"Those animals are being left to die of sadness"


"The anomalous situation and our proposals were brought to the attention of both the technical and political officials of the Arrecife City Council without us having received a response, thousands of signatures have been delivered supporting our demands and even complaints have been filed with the Prosecutor's Office, since we can assure that in some matters the Animal Protection Law of the Canary Islands is not being complied with," says the 'Platform against animal abuse'

"Until now, the feeling they convey to us is that they are stalling the matter and the problems remain unresolved," criticizes this group of citizens, who points out that "while this is happening, those animals are being left to die of sadness."

 

Platform Claims


Thus, they demand that they be allowed to "attend to them and groom them" and that "on the City Council's website there be a space where the work that is being carried out is displayed while facilitating adoption." They also request that "a wide range of visiting hours be established that is respected so that volunteers can carry out their work in an organized manner."

"We are not asking for the impossible, municipalities such as Tinajo and Haría already do it, which leads us to think that this issue only requires the necessary political will of those who have the responsibility," says the 'Platform against animal abuse', which warns that it is not going to "allow this situation to continue." "From respect for the institutions, the laws and above all those beings who give us everything in exchange for nothing, we need a 180° turn to reverse a situation that disqualifies us as civilized beings," he concludes.
